# Client setup for Hushgate, our alert deduplicator.
# Heads up: Hushgate collapses duplicate pages within a 90s window,
# so don't be surprised if your test alerts vanish — that's the point.
# The client needs the internal dedup service key at init, or it
# silently falls back to passthrough mode (bad!).
# Grab the key here:

API key for tagef-fafop: vxb2-ta

Consolidated gross margin fell from 41.2% to 38.6%, largely attributable to component inflation on the Serran sensor range and unfavourable mix in the Quarrow export channel. We have modelled three recovery paths: supplier renegotiation, selective price increases, and discontinuation of low-volume variants. Each is detailed in the attached workbook. Please review before Thursday's session and prepare departmental impacts. The confidential planning context appears directly below.

confidential, kagup-bafog: Fraaxax Group is in early talks to buy Soroxox Group for about $343.8 million. The Olidor launch date is June 14, and nothing goes to the press before then. Legal wants the Aldmirek Logistics term sheet signed before July 23.

Plugin authors normally interact with the Renderloft farm only through the sandboxed Filament API. In rare cases — a stuck transcode queue corrupting downstream jobs, or a plugin wedging a worker node — break-glass access to the farm console may be granted. Requests go through the Marrowgate duty officer and expire after four hours. All console sessions are recorded and reviewed by the Oxhaven platform team. Once access is approved, authenticate to the emergency console with the recovery passphrase below.

recovery phrase for bawef-haduf: wenax-druox-julmir

// REINDEX_BATCH_CAP limits docs per shard pass in the Tallowfield
// nightly search reindex. Raising it starves the ingest queue;
// lowering it overruns the maintenance window. 5000 is the tested
// sweet spot. Change only with a soak run. Verified against the
// build noted below.

session token of bawif-hahog = htk6_ac5981